Related: About this forumBernie Sanders isn’t a woman, but is he a better feminist than Hillary Clinton?
"Pundits in the U.S. see Hillary Clinton in deep trouble with women voters after her spectacular loss to Bernie Sanders in New Hampshire.
While Clintons three percent lead among women voters in Iowa helped give her a whisper-thin win in the nations first caucus, her 11 percent deficit among women voters in New Hampshire helped Bernie Sanders to a landslide victory in the nations first primary. Clearly, the votes of women are playing a pivotal role this primary season.
Add to that the recent controversies over Clinton supporters Madeleine Albright, who claimed there is a special place in hell for women who dont support women, and Gloria Steinem, who suggested young women were supporting Sanders because the boys are with Bernie, and the Clinton campaign is less sure than ever that it can win the womans vote even among feminists."
Cythia Weber, The Conversation
